Eligibility criteria

As a Nucleus Member, you will contribute to the ongoing work and development of the Council on Stroke.

Eligibility criteria:

  • Candidates must be members of the Council on Stroke
  • Only Council members whose place of work is an ESC member country can be elected to Nucleus positions
  • Persons who, if elected, will hold simultaneously positions on Nuclei/Boards of other ESC Constituent Bodies, are not eligible 
  • Limitations of cumulative positions within the ESC: In order to ensure a renewal within the ESC and a good internal functioning, an officer may not hold more than three leadership positions at the same time
  • Limitation of representation within ESC Constituent Bodies: for the duration of their mandates, nucleus members cannot simultaneously hold another position as an elected Nucleus / Board Member in an ESC Association, Working Group or another Council, unless if co-opted in a non-voting position
  • Limitations of years of service within a nucleus: Council nucleus members may remain on one same nucleus a maximum of 12 years (consecutive or not).

All candidates must be a member of the same council at the time of the application deadline, 31 March 2024, and still have a valid membership on 27 May 2024.
